Transaction 70f8216381d931773128c4378e11284a99a9b2133eaf966b5980d95b4a624a55

1 Input
2 Outputs
  • 70f8216381d931773128c4378e11284a99a9b2133eaf966b5980d95b4a624a55:0
  • value  35348000
    address  15h7L5BKdaRgpMJES2vWSs91otYCEMmTt8
  • 70f8216381d931773128c4378e11284a99a9b2133eaf966b5980d95b4a624a55:1
  • value  326994000
    address  19GXksR8QgNCLFFfg6s4kpyX6zZUVgZcCG